Hot Out? Think About Frying
Sunday July 20, 2008
Why? Because with respect to roasting, stewing, or even boiling frying is quicker, and therefore heats the kitchen less. Properly cooked fried foods are also light, and can be wonderfully refreshing too. While many areas of Italy are known for their fritti misti, mixed fried food meals, fried foods are also excellent antipasti and party foods. Some examples of the latter:
- Mozzarella Fritta, Fried Mozzarella: A delight!
- Isernia's Fried Calzoni, stuffed with a savory ricotta filling
- Arancini di Riso, Sicily's golden orbs
- Fried cod, with a tasty egg-and-lemon sauce
- Cotoletta alla Milanese, a breaded veal cutlet. Perfect with lots of lemon and a green salad.
- Pollo Fritto, fried chicken: A universal dish.
